Output d78f77e7648cc3d65b1e35d3e3d271bcf8bc4d98583387dbe61baaa91fc19cfc:1

value
543760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82c05e2ca2d74b072959a03d4873e38a0ade4ec6 OP_EQUAL
address
3DcNDSDQZam4YLG65BZ2w3kRMJcm5F5bs5
transaction
d78f77e7648cc3d65b1e35d3e3d271bcf8bc4d98583387dbe61baaa91fc19cfc
confirmations
274982
spent
true